embedding: refactor public ArrayBufferAllocator
API
Use a RAII approach by default, and make it possible for embedders to use the `ArrayBufferAllocator` directly as a V8 `ArrayBuffer::Allocator`, e.g. when passing to `Isolate::CreateParams` manually.
